The Effect of Knee Braces on Quadriceps Strength and Inhibition in Subjects With Patellofemoral Osteoarthritis

Synopsis
126 patients with patellofemoral joint (PFJ) osteoarthritis (OA) were randomized to either a knee support brace, or a control group without brace support for 6 weeks. The purpose of this study was to determine the effects of a flexible knee brace on quadriceps maximum voluntary contraction (MVC) and athrogenous muscle inhibition (AMI) in PFJ OA patients.
